Daniel William "Danny" May (born 19 November 1988) is an English footballer who plays for Kings Langley. He plays mostly as a right back.
May came through Northampton Town's youth system and agreed a professional contract in April 2007.[2] He made his first team début on 21 April 2007 in a 1–0 win over Chesterfield. He made two more appearances at the end of the 2006–07 season. He made three subsequent appearances in the 2007–08 season, the last against Leeds United on 5 January 2008. He was released at the end of the 2007–08 season.[3]
He dropped six divisions, joining Wivenhoe Town, in August 2008. Signed for Enfield Town in February 2009. He joined Hemel Hempstead Town for the start of the 2009-10 season.
As of August 2015, May is with Southern League Division One Central side Kings Langley.
